Humberto Escalante is a scholar working on Building and Construction, Biomedical Engineering and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Humberto Escalante has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 670 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Building and Construction, 12 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 9 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Humberto Escalante’s work include Anaerobic Digestion and Biogas Production (22 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(11 papers) and Agriculture Sustainability and Environmental Impact (9 papers). Humberto Escalante is often cited by papers focused on Anaerobic Digestion and Biogas Production (22 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(11 papers) and Agriculture Sustainability and Environmental Impact (9 papers). Humberto Escalante collaborates with scholars based in Colombia, Spain and Ecuador. Humberto Escalante's co-authors include Liliana Castro, Jaime Jaimes-Estévez, Paola Gauthier‐Maradei, Marianna Garfí, Ivet Ferrer, Jader Rodríguez, Jaime Martí-Herrero, Ángel Irabien, Giovanni Rojas and V. Bubnovich and has published in prestigious journals such as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ews, The Science of The Total Environment and Bioresource Technology.
